Knowing how to attract foreign direct investment is among the most fundamental lessons for nations and governments to learn. For host countries, there are in fact several ways to attract foreign direct investment that they can think about. For a start, among the best pointers is to create labor forces in local communities, as shown by the India FDI landscape. This is because having a competent, experienced and capable pool of employees is one of the key things that international investors seek when considering their financial investments. To create this labor force, governments need to introduce different education and training schemes to ensure that their local citizens have the understanding, abilities and expertise to compete in the international marketplace. Moreover, another crucial strategy for boosting foreign direct investment is to concentrate on building strong international relationships in between various other countries. To put more info it simply, countries can hold networking events and global workshops to help them develop partnerships with other countries, international organizations, and global investors, which in turn can enable them to promote their business environment, attract investment and give access to brand-new markets.

The overall benefits of foreign direct investment have been well-documented by research and data. Although there are undoubtedly advantages for the capitalists themselves, the major benefits affect the actual host nation itself. For instance, having businesspeople invest in your nation is an effective way to enhance the overall economic situation; these FDI initiatives can improve the nation's infrastructure, it develops plenty of jobs for the residents and integrates the host country into worldwide markets, as demonstrated by the Singapore FDI landscape. Considering that foreign direct investment can stimulate economical expansion, it is really important for nations to comprehend how to increase foreign direct investment from various other investors. As a beginning point, the primary step is to carry out some market research. This means researching some target sectors and businesses which are flourishing in your country and could benefit from various worldwide expansion opportunities. As an example, countries must leverage any type of local trade opportunities which could possibly be taken to another level and lead to advantages for other countries or investors. Conducting market research offers you a clear and precise insight into the challenges, preferences and needs of the international investor, which then enables the host nation to craft tailored value proposals that resonate with the investors and align with their goals.

Foreign direct investment can be a complicated prospect, particularly with the numerous different factors influencing foreign direct investment which come into play. This is why it is essential for nations to have a clear understanding of how to encourage foreign direct investment. A great suggestion is to try and mentally put themselves into the shoes of an international investor. Essentially, global investors always try to find a steady and predictable business environment when they are considering investing in a nation, as shown by the Malta FDI scene. Consequently, this indicates that host countries have to put in place a straightforward regulative structure that is easy for overseas investors to traverse. Simply put, all legislations, guidelines and policies should be plainly stated and are implemented consistently at all times. Most significantly, host nations need to additionally ensure that there is political stability and minimal corruption, in order to reassure and develop trust with global investors.
